Output 7d80395c82ceb9eb259c87629dd607f77b0c02424ae271bfcf2474e3138b74bd:3

value
20875374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d684bb5d049ee17f4009c20701057819109158 OP_EQUAL
address
MHNCpCDqVF76tMjhvFT5ukPB5UvA9wavLs
transaction
7d80395c82ceb9eb259c87629dd607f77b0c02424ae271bfcf2474e3138b74bd
spent
true